Library: English | How to Avoid Becoming a Victim of Insurance Fraud A Consumer Guide for Asian Americans. An illustrated brochure describing the warning signs of insurance fraud, with some concrete steps you can take to avoid becoming a victim. Though written specifically to help Asian Americans, this brochure contains information helpful to all consumers. It details several types of insurance fraud, such as: fake policies, premium fraud, unlicensed agents, unnecessary services, and insurance scams. Library: English | Assistance for Victims of Crime . A fact sheet that describes a program called the "Restitution Fund." Under California law, this allows certain victims of crime to receive financial assistance for losses resulting from a crime, which cannot be reimbursed from other sources.
